Two major issues with assets packs and Godot is that adding collision shapes to multiple meshes isn't available currently (from what I've read and tested).
You can create a Trimesh Static Body for multiple meshes, but it is two dense and expensive. The other collisions types won't apply to multiple meshes.
For large asset packs such as these it makes it near impossible to go through each individual assets mesh on by one and place them easily.
The other issue currently in Godot is there is no mesh asset browser to place assets. You have to go through each mesh in the file browser and read the individual names of meshes in order to place them. You could be very organised and create many folders to hold your assets, but this still isn't ideal.
There is a built in 3D Gridmap in Godot, but each mesh has to be the same size.
An alternate plugin is available called 'Asset Placer', but this is $17.99 / £15. It is something that should really be included in Godot.

There are 3 separate keys, one for each tier, that must be added to your cart.
[Edit with info from Synty]
The Humble bundle and the BYOB sales are separate and cannot be combined, which is super confusing since they list it as a BYOB + Humble sale. From Synty : "You need to process these on separate orders. Discounts aren't stackable on the store and both the Humble Bundle and the build your own bundle discounts are done in the same way using a discount code on the store so they need to be placed in their own orders."
